Working with Parts
The following sections explain how to work with parts as you create and
edit designs. It covers the ways that you can place parts on the board, as
well as the tools included to help you with part location and placement. It
also includes information on Ultiboard’s parts database, and editing the
parts in the database and on the board.
Some of the described features may not be available in your edition of
Ultiboard. Refer to the NI Circuit Design Suite Release Notes for a list of
the features in your edition.
Placing Parts
You can place parts on the design:
• by dragging them from outside the board outline. Refer to the
Dragging Parts from Outside the Board Outline section for more
information.
• by using the Spreadsheet View. Refer to the Using the Parts Tab in
the Spreadsheet View section for more information.
• by importing a netlist. Refer to the Creating a Design from a Netlist
File section of Chapter 2, Beginning a Design, for more information.
• by selecting parts from the database. Refer to the Placing Parts from
the Database section for more information.
Note Before placing a part, make sure that you are on the layer where the part is to be
placed. Refer to the Accessing Layers section of Chapter 3, Setting Up a Design, for more
information.
Dragging Parts from Outside the Board Outline
By default, parts are placed outside the board outline when you open a
netlist from Multisim or another schematic capture program. These can be
dragged to the appropriate location on the board.
